Written between January and September 1924, The desert of love was published as a serial in La Revue de Paris from 15 November 1924 to 1 January 1925. Mauriac develops the history and personalities of certain characters seen in The River of Fire and The Kiss to the Leper. The work, which uses retrospection, is now considered to be his greatest technical achievement.
